BOT GIVES STATE BANKS PERMISSION TO SET UP JVS FOR MANAGEMENT OF BAD DEBTS

The Bank of Thailand (BOT) has permitted state-run banks to establish a joint venture asset management company (JV AMC) to manage bad debts accumulated since the Covid-19 pandemic. The move aims to reduce the economic impact of non-performing loans (NPLs) incurred from banks' loan programs. The JV AMC will focus on long-term debt settlement through debt restructuring and payment criteria adjustment, aligning with the government's policy of eliminating debt problems. (ICE BANGKOK)
